Full Job Description
Position Summary

We're searching for an Industry Events & Experiences Lead for Samsung Ads to join our dynamic Samsung Ads team within Samsung Electronics America.

This role will elevate Samsung Ads in the industry and promote the sellable solutions that allow advertisers to reach their most important audiences. This position will be based in Los Angeles or New York City.

Role and Responsibilities

The Industry Events and Experiences Lead will be responsible for all planning and on-the-ground execution at the industry's biggest stages - CES, IAB NewFronts, Cannes Lions, Possible, and beyond. This is brand-building, not box-checking: you'll own the full lifecycle of our marquee events, from portfolio strategy and creative direction through vendor negotiation, budget ownership, and on-site execution, to post-event ROI reporting. You'll partner closely with sales, brand marketing, communications, operations, creative and executive leadership to ensure every activation reflects Samsung Ads at its best.

The ideal candidate moves fluidly between big-picture strategy and on-the-ground detail, stays composed under pressure, and has the flexibility to travel as needed - including evenings and weekends around event windows.

The scope of the role includes the following:

Strategy & Creative Direction
  • Architect the annual industry events portfolio and investment strategy with sales, marketing, and leadership - deciding which events, at what scale, and why
  • Set the creative vision for each activation - environmental design and layout, guest journey, content - so our presence feels distinct, not templated
  • Develop event briefs covering objectives, audiences, budgets, staffing, and success metrics; scout new venues and sponsorship opportunities

Execution & Vendor Management
  • Lead end-to-end logistics: venue sourcing, production, staffing, credentialing, and on-site operations
  • Manage and negotiate with agencies, production partners, and vendors; serve as on-the-ground lead, troubleshooting in real time
  • Manage sponsorship commitments to maximize visibility and value from every partnership

Cross-Functional Partnership
  • Collaborate with sales, marketing, comms, and executive leadership on all aspects of events - aligning stakeholders early and briefing executives on logistics and talking points
  • Build reusable playbooks, briefing templates, and vendor rosters to make each event faster and stronger than the last

Budget & Measurement
  • Own event budgets end-to-end: forecasting, tracking, reconciliation, and post-event financial reporting
  • Track KPIs beyond attendance - engagement, leads, media impressions, stakeholder sentiment, brand perception - and deliver recaps with recommendations for future investment
  • Benchmark against industry best practices and competitor activations
